Quote:
Originally Posted by VTENGR View Post
The setting you describe about shutting the car off when you walk away. That's for the iDrive system. You can have it set so that the iDrive shuts off when you open the door, or stays on. So after you drive, you stop the engine, open the door, the iDrive will shut down.
this is also an inconsistent action for my 45e. i have it set in iDrive to shut off when trip complete (drive state OFF, open door). I understand the "habitual" actions required for this system, but still even today, iDrive did not shut off when I opened the door at the end of my trip. not the end of the world, but it's hard to find consistency where it doesn't seem to exist.

another case in point is its "ACC" capability. when is the power to the central console 12V plug turned off? I have an external dash camera plugged into it. Sometimes it turns off after some minutes after I've ended my trip but other times it stays on. It doesn't matter if the doors are locked or unlocked. Just yesterday after a 7-hour workday, I approached my car (did not unlock it yet) and noticed my dash camera still on, so power to the 12V battery didn't turn off even after locking the car upon arrival to work. just odd behavior...
